DEFINITION

Classification: 530/339

Segment condensation, e.g., ugi condensation, etc.:

(under subclass 338) Processes in which peptides of two or more amino acid residues are joined with other peptide of two or more amino acid residues to form a single large peptide.

(1) Note. These processes are also called fragment condensation.
